Thought I should post this up as I've been searching for ages!
I've had Ebay Subaru gold caliper paint, Honda Inca Y61P and various others that honestly were not even close. So I wandered into my local model shop as I know they sell lots of little pots and bought 4, tried them all and I've found a perfect match!! Humbrol 54, Metallic Brass! :luxhello: Attachment 57921 It's 100%, the pearl and everything is perfect and the best bit.... £3 a tin! Some of this in the chips/scratches left to dry properly and maybe a little clearcoat on top and i think we have a winner! Hope this is useful :thumb: |
